The Ministry of Health (Kemenkes) recorded 38 districts/cities with weekly inpatient utilization above the national average, currently recorded at 0.35 patients per 100,000 population/week, data as of Tuesday, March 14, 2023.
The five districts/cities with the highest inpatient utilization, exceeding 0.98 patients per 100,000 population/week, are Kediri City, Madiun City, Pontianak City, Kulon Progo, and Sleman, with respective values of 1.36 patients per 100,000 population/week, 1.12 patients per 100,000 population/week, 1.04 patients per 100,000 population/week, 0.98 patients per 100,000 population/week, and 0.98 patients per 100,000 population/week, respectively.
A recapitulation of national Covid-19 data from the Ministry of Health shows an increase in inpatient utilization in most districts/cities outside Java. Twelve districts/cities recorded higher daily inpatient utilization than previously, while two districts/cities recorded lower inpatient utilization.
Areas outside Java with the highest inpatient utilization include Pontianak City, Kepahiang, and Palangkaraya City, with inpatient utilization rates of 1.04 patients per 100,000 population/week, 0.69 patients per 100,000 population/week, and 0.67 patients per 100,000 population/week, respectively.
